Window Replacement

Window replacement is an excellent option to improve the efficiency of your home, reduce noise, and improve security. However, it is essential to speak with a reputable manufacturer or service provider to make sure that the new units are of top quality, properly sized and properly installed. This will maximize your investment and help you achieve the most effective results. In addition replacement windows are a good choice for older homes with old single pane windows that don't adequately insulate or block UV rays.

The replacement of your window glass is among the most cost-effective methods to upgrade your home's insulation and efficiency. New uPVC frames and wooden frames offer superior insulation against rain, wind, and cold. Double-glazed units with low emissivity (low e) coatings, low-emissivity argon gas, and coatings help reduce heat transfer and reduce energy bills. The best double-paned windows also acoustically-insulated and have multi-point locking mechanisms for enhanced security.

Replacement of a single pane within double-glazed windows can cost between PS55 and PS145, depending on its size and design. It's usually more affordable to repair a blown window, and it's essential to have a professional evaluation of the situation and suggestions prior to deciding whether you want to replace or repair your windows.

If you have a double-glazed windows that has a misty appearance it is a sign of a leak between the glass panes or an issue with the seal. A specialized repair method can be used to get rid of the moisture and then clean the glass unit and put in an additional spacer bar and a desiccant in order to prevent further condensation. The repair procedure can be done at home or on site and is usually less expensive than replacing the entire window.

It's more cost-effective to replace the double pane that has been damaged, but not always the glass. Double-paned windows have a gap in between the two panes of glass which is sealed with argon or Krypton gas. This creates an airtight seal, and reduces the loss of energy. In order to maintain energy efficiency and ensure an airtight seal that is tight it is typically necessary to replace the entire window if a single glass pane breaks.

Misted Double Glazing

Misted double glazing is a serious problem for homeowners. It can alter the way windows function and lead to dampness and mold. It is crucial to fix any problems with double glazing promptly, especially as winter approaches.

Misting occurs when the glass in your window is sprayed with condensation between the glass panes. This is usually due to poor installation and air infiltration. The best way to prevent this is to use a FENSA approved window installer.

Keep your double glazing clear of dust, dirt and other debris. Warm soapy water applied to the frames is the simplest method of cleaning the majority of uPVC double glazing. If the frames are constructed from aluminum or wood it is possible to employ other methods to thoroughly clean them.

One of the most common problems that double glazing owners face after installation is that their windows or doors become difficult to open or close. This is often caused by extreme temperatures as the frame expands or shrinks depending on the weather. You can try to adjust the hinges, handles and mechanisms by using cold or hot water. If this fails, you might want to consider contacting the company that installed your double glazing, as they may offer a refund or repair service.

If your double-glazed windows have begun to mist this could indicate that the seal in between the two glass panes has failed. There are a variety of reasons for this, such as old age, poor installation or the use of harsh cleaning products or chemicals that contain oil. You should also use a FENSA-regulated installer to make sure that your double-glazing complies fully with UK building regulations.

In some instances misting of a double glazing unit can be repaired by replacing the spacer bar with one that is a bit warmer. This will increase the temperature of the glass and assist to prevent condensation. Alternatively, you can use thermally efficient glass that has low emission coatings and argon gas between the glass to reduce condensation.

Skylight Repair

Skylights are a great way to let natural light into a home without making it too bright. They also work well for adding extra insulation, which will help to reduce heating costs. Like all windows and doors, they may experience a variety of problems. If a double pane skylight becomes damaged, it is essential to get a professional to fix it as quickly as you can. This will stop condensation, water leaks and other damage to the frame and glass.

Skylight leaks typically occur when the flashing and glazing seal loosen or when the frame begins corroding. These issues can lead to leaking water through the frame and into the ceiling. A contractor can fix a skylight that is leaking by sealing or replacing the flashing, seal, and frame. The cost to repair a skylight varies depending on the size of the window and type of glass. It may be worth replacing the entire frame if it is badly damaged.

Another issue with skylights is the presence of mold. Mold can appear on the outside, inside or in the frame of the skylight. The reason for the mold may be due to a leak in the water or condensation or an improper sealing. If the mold is restricted to the area around the window, minor repairs can be completed. If the mold is widespread the skylight may require replacement.
